Director: Charles Martin Smith
Cast: Robert Dunne, James Garner, Adam Arkin, Eric Roberts
A teenaged Mark Twain travels to the American West during the "Gold Rush" days in search of fortune and his destiny.

Roughing It is a book of semi-autobiographical travel literature by Mark Twain. It was written in 1870–71 and published in 1872, following his first travel book The Innocents Abroad (1869). Roughing It is dedicated to Twain's mining companion Calvin H. Higbie, later a civil engineer who died in 1914.
